Dr. Osterbauer is an Advanced Proficiency Rated Activator Chiropractor and a Certified Posture Education Professional®. He is Professor Emeritus and Adjunct Faculty at Northwestern Health Sciences University where he has taught for over 25 years. He is excited to bring his expertise and experience to help support your health and well-being.
A 1986 graduate of Northwestern College of Chiropractic, he received his Master’s Degree in Public Health from the University of Washington in 1993. After working with Dr. Fuhr, founder of Activator Methods International, for 10 years in Arizona, Dr. Osterbauer relocated to Texas to continue chiropractic research at the Texas Back Institute. He returned to Minnesota in 1998 to teach and research at Northwestern Health Sciences University (formerly Northwestern College of Chiropractic).
In the Methods Department of Northwestern Health Sciences University, he developed & taught courses in Geriatrics and participated in an interprofessional Geriatric Residency pilot program. He also taught Evidence Based Programming to strengthen posture, developed by Dr. Stephen Weiniger of BodyZone®.
